Crime Blotter for the Week of June 12-18, 2022

The following is a synopsis of crimes reported for the week of June 12 - 18, 2022:        
 
 June 12, 2022

  • Arson:
Mel Canyon Road and Royal Oaks Drive.  On June 12, 2022 at approximately 4:18 PM, suspect(s) unknown set fire to the hillside of the area. The fire started approximately 35 feet from the K-rails at MelCanyon Road and Brookridge Road. Per fire investigators the fire was not started by natural causes.  No surveillance video available. 

June 13, 2022
  • Grand theft:
Crestfield Drive and Bloomdale Street. Between June 9, 2022, 8 PM and June 13, 2022, 8:30 AM, suspect(s) unknown stole the catalytic converter to the victims parked vehicle a gray 2000 Honda Accord. Loss was approximately $1,600. No surveillance video available.
  • Grand Theft:
2315 Huntington Drive (CVS).  On June 13, 2022 at 5:41 PM, suspects unknown, two female black adults, were observed on surveillance entering the location carrying large tote bags and walking directly to the cosmetic area. The suspects made multiple selections of cosmetics and concealed the items inside their tote bags. The suspects walked out of the location failing to pay for the items. Loss was approximately $2,600. Surveillance video available.   
 
June 14, 2022
  • Burglary (Vehicle):
1193 Huntington Drive (Planet Fitness).  On June 14, 2022 between 5:30 AM and 6:45 AM, suspect(s) unknown shattered the front passenger side window to victim’s vehicle, a red Hyundai Elantra. Suspect(s) stole a black backpack containing miscellaneous items from the vehicle. Loss was approximately $300. No surveillance video available.
 
June 15, 2022
  • Grand Theft Auto:
1210 Royal Oaks Drive. Between June 8, 2022 at 1 PM and June 15, 2022 at 8 PM, suspect(s) unknown stole the victims parked vehicle a White 2019 Mercedes Azzo. No surveillance video available. Vehicle recovered.
 
June 16, 2022
  • Petty Theft:
2500 Block of Elda Street Huntington.  On June 16, 2022 at 3 PM, suspect unknown, a male adult wearing an Amazon uniform, was observed on surveillance walking up to the location and taking a package from the doorstep. The suspect entered a yellow Kia EV6 vehicle and fled the area. Loss was approximately $700. Surveillance video available.  
  • Grand Theft:
2000 block of Broach Avenue.  On 0June 16, 2022 at 4:45 AM, two unknown suspect(s) wearing dark clothing were observed on video surveillance taking the catalytic converter to the victims parked vehicle a 2003 Honda Accord. Suspects fled the area in an unknown vehicle. Loss was approximately $1,000.
  • Grand Theft Auto:
Fernley Drive and Crestfield Drive. Between June 15, 2022 at 10:48 PM and June 16, 2022 at 9:05 AM, suspect(s) unknown stole the victims parked vehicle a white 2017 Ford F650. No surveillance video available. Vehicle outstanding.

CRIME PREVENTION TIPS
 SOCIAL MEDIA HYGIENE by LASD Fraud & Cyber Crimes Bureau (Part 1)
 
Why Is This Important?
 
·  Safety: Your social media posts may reveal who you are and where you live.
 
·  Negative Effects: Your social media posts may negatively affect your career and your professional reputation.
 
·  Identity Theft: Your social media posts may contain enough information for criminals to impersonate you.
 
·  There is no ‘Delete’ Button on the Internet: Remember, once something is posted on the Internet, people can screenshot it, search engines can store it, social networking sites can save it, and it is never going away. Do Your Part, #BeCyberSmart.
 
·  Self-Assessment: Attempt to locate yourself. This exercise will help determine how much personal information about you is available online. Below are some standard tools to search for your name, D.O.B, email addresses, and phone number.
 
-Online search engines: Google, Bing, Yahoo, and Yandex.
-People search tools: Truepeoplesearch.com, whitepages.com, spydialer.com, usphonebook.com, familytreenow.com, spytox.com, searchpeoplefree.com, number.com, and webmii.com.
